Не может найти директорию php
У меня есть код php:
$tmp_name = $_FILES["post"]["tmp_name"];
$name = basename($_FILES["post"]["name"]);
echo $name;
if (is_uploaded_file($_FILES['post']['tmp_name'])) {
echo 'true';
move_uploaded_file($tmp_name, "$upload_dir/$name");
} else {
echo 'false';
}
так же есть код ajax:
let post = false;
$('input[name="post"]').change(function (e) {
post = e.target.files[0];
});
formData.append('post', post);
$.ajax({
url: "db/admin-panel-code.php",
method: "POST",
dataType: "json",
processData: false,
contentType: false,
cache: false,
data: formData,
success(data) {
}
});
Проблема в том, что выдает ошибки Warning: move_uploaded_file(images/logo-23.webp): failed to open stream: No such file or directory in D:\OpenServer\domains\publichtml\db\admin-panel-code.php on line 74
и
Warning: move_uploaded_file(): Unable to move 'D:\OpenServer\userdata\php_upload\php5B9C.tmp' to '/images/logo-23.webp' in D:\OpenServer\domains\publichtml\db\admin-panel-code.php on line 75. Работаю на версии php 7.4, так же file_uploads = on